Cooking Instructions
- 1
Please ensure to but the base of the ice cream maker in the refrigerator for 12 hours. The base has to be cold in order for the ice cream to change consistency.
- 2
Place egg yolk and sugar in a bowl and beat together.
- 3
In a saucepan slowly bring the milk to boiling
point, and then pour onto the egg mixture beating together. - 4
Return the mixture to the pan and stir constantly
until the mixture thickens and forms a film over the back of the spoon. Do not let it boil or the mixture will
separate. Remove from heat and leave until cold. - 5
Stir in the cream and vanilla extract. Pour the mixture into the
freezer bowl with the paddle running. Allow to freeze until the desired consistency is achieved.
